Barclays US economist Pooja Sriram discussed expectations for the upcoming July Consumer Price Index (CPI) report, emphasizing that the recent softer inflation reading in June is likely to be short-lived. She noted that while the July CPI data may not be decisive on its own, it remains a critical data point for markets and policymakers, especially following last Friday's relatively soft payrolls report which eased concerns about a reacceleration in economic activity. Sriram highlighted that inflation data will play a key role in shaping expectations ahead of the Federal Reserve's next meeting, with all eyes on whether inflation rebounds as anticipated. The segment underscored the significance of CPI and PPI data as the next major test for the Fed's policy direction. (Source: Bloomberg)
